MBA Programs Offering Full Scholarships: A Guide
If you are considering pursuing a Master of Business Administration (MBA) degree, you may be aware of the financial investment required to enroll in such programs. However, there are opportunities available for aspiring MBA students to receive full scholarships that cover the cost of tuition, fees, and other expenses. In this article, we will explore some MBA programs that offer full scholarships to help you achieve your academic and career goals without the burden of financial constraints.
1. Stanford Graduate School of Business
Stanford Graduate School of Business is renowned for its prestigious MBA program and its commitment to supporting students from diverse backgrounds. The school offers full-tuition scholarships to admitted students based on merit, leadership potential, and personal contributions. These scholarships are highly competitive, but they provide an excellent opportunity for deserving candidates to pursue their MBA at one of the top business schools in the world.
2. Harvard Business School
Harvard Business School is another leading institution that offers full scholarships to exceptional MBA candidates. The school's financial aid program ensures that admitted students with demonstrated need can attend the program without the burden of student loans. In addition to need-based scholarships, Harvard Business School also awards merit-based scholarships to outstanding applicants who demonstrate academic excellence and leadership potential.

3. Wharton School of the University of Pennsylvania
The Wharton School is known for its rigorous MBA program and its commitment to fostering innovation and entrepreneurship. The school offers a range of full scholarships to incoming students, including the Joseph Wharton Fellowship, which covers tuition and living expenses for two years. In addition to the fellowship, Wharton also provides scholarships based on academic achievement, professional experience, and other criteria.
4. Booth School of Business, University of Chicago
The Booth School of Business at the University of Chicago is a top-ranked business school that attracts talented students from around the world. The school offers full-tuition scholarships to a select number of admitted students who demonstrate exceptional academic achievement and leadership potential. These scholarships are awarded based on merit and are designed to support students throughout their MBA program.

Frequently Asked Questions
What Are The Top Mba Programs That Offer Full Scholarships?
Some of the top MBA programs that offer full scholarships are Harvard Business School, Stanford Graduate School of Business, Wharton School of the University of Pennsylvania, and Chicago Booth School of Business.
What Are The Eligibility Criteria For Getting A Full Scholarship For An Mba Program?
The eligibility criteria for getting a full scholarship for an MBA program vary from school to school. Generally, academic excellence, leadership potential, and financial need are some of the common criteria.
How Can I Increase My Chances Of Getting A Full Scholarship For An Mba Program?
To increase your chances of getting a full scholarship for an MBA program, you can focus on maintaining a high GPA, gaining relevant work experience, demonstrating leadership skills, and networking with alumni and current students.
Can International Students Apply For Full Scholarships For Mba Programs?
Yes, many MBA programs offer full scholarships to international students. However, the eligibility criteria and application process may vary from those for domestic students.
